What's yours when it comes to cigars? 
Being new to all this, I'm trying to get taste for what I like. At this point I feel spending a lot on something good one would kinda a waste of money...So I'm trying as many different cheaper cigars as I can without breaking the bank and wasting a good cigar till I get the feel of things.
So I hoping you guys have something you go to for less than $5 a stick.

  • Amos_UmwhatAmos_Umwhat Posts: 8,405 ✭✭✭✭✭
    ForMud said:
     I'm hoping you guys have something you go to for less than $5 a stick.    

    You might try seconds from makers you're curious about, to start.  Or, lower priced blends from well known makers, for example, the Curly Heads from Fuente come in different wrappers, so a 5-pack of each can give you an idea of different tastes, and I think 5 are less that $15 if I'm not mistaken.

  • peter4jcpeter4jc Posts: 15,315 ✭✭✭✭✭
    Based on how many 'agrees' you have there, that is something many can relate to.  I know I can. 

    The same goes for buying samplers; everybody says "buy samplers, it'll help figure out what you like" so I bought tons of samplers.  But then once I started knowing what I liked, at least half the cigars in most of the samplers were sticks I didn't like.
